Police are searching for a second suspect in a Bronx shooting last month that killed a 34-year-old man. Kelvin Mosquea was fatally shot outside his home at 710 Croes Ave. in Clason Point on Aug. 26, shortly after 1 p.m., police said. Officers from the 43rd Precinct found him unconscious and unresponsive with a gunshot wound to the torso.
Everyone loves a good medieval whodunit, but how did real people investigate homicides in the Middle Ages? What did they look for? And how did they decide if a person's death was an unfortunate accident or foul play? This week, Danièle speaks with Sara Butler about forensic medicine, and how death investigation was conducted in medieval England. Sara Butler is a Professor at The Ohio State University, where her research focuses on social and legal history in the Middle Ages. This conversation is based on her book Forensic Medicine and Death Investigation in Medieval England.

A second person has died as a result of a house fire in Richmond Hill, Ont., on Monday, according to York Regional Police. The victim, a 24-year-old woman, died on Wednesday in hospital of her injuries. In a news release on Thursday, police identified her as Helya Bahari-Kashani of Richmond Hill. An 11-year-old girl, also injured in the blaze, died in hospital on Tuesday. Three other people hurt in the fire remain in critical condition in hospital.
